tvN’s “Mouse” released a new behind-the-scenes look at the drama!

“Mouse” is about an innocent and upright police officer named Jung Ba Reum (Lee Seung Gi) and a hardened detective named Go Moo Chi (Lee Hee Joon) who believes in nothing but revenge against the serial killer who murdered his parents. The two team up to track down an evil psychopathic predator.

The new making-of video begins with Lee Seung Gi and Park Ju Hyun discussing their upcoming scene. Park Ju Hyun asks the director, “Should I just feed him with my hand?” and Lee Seung Gi suggests that he’ll bring out a set of utensils. Lee Seung Gi gets confused when everyone laughs, so the director explains, “I felt your strong desire to not eat something touched by her hands.”

In another scene, Lee Hee Joon thoughtfully helps shield Park Ju Hyun from the rain after she wraps up filming. The director praises Park Ju Hyun for her acting, and she shares, “It’s an emotional scene, but Lee Hee Joon calmed me down. When asked if she’s cold, Park Ju Hyun replies that she’s okay since many other people are cold as well. She shares, “It’s difficult, but since we’re filming happily, please show us lots of love!”

Lee Seung Gi also skillfully takes on difficult action scenes with help from the martial arts director, and he carefully rehearses his lines with Lee Hee Joon. After listening to the director’s instructions for Lee Seung Gi, Lee Hee Joon comments, “That must be difficult. I just have to scream.”

Kyung Soo Jin and Lee Seung Gi have an awkward reunion after meeting each other for the first time in a month. Lee Seung Gi shares, “Let’s be close from now on.” After Lee Hee Joon compliments Kyung Soo Jin, she notices the making-of camera and asks, “Did you compliment me after seeing the camera?”

Lee Seung Gi and Kyung Soo Jin also explain their age difference to Lee Hee Joon. Kyung Soo Jin shares she decided to address Lee Seung Gi as oppa since he was born earlier in the year, and Lee Seung Gi comments, “Soo Jin must have wanted me to buy her a meal.” When Lee Hee Joon agrees that Lee Seung Gi should buy the meal if he is older, Lee Seung Gi proceeds to call him hyung and father. Kyung Soo Jin asks Lee Seung Gi, “Why are you so good at talking?” and he responds, “It’s just my job.”
